    Abstract
    T he concept of bistability is well-established in the study of dynamical systems [1]. The key feature of a dynamical system is that the state of the system changes as a function of time. The living cell offers several examples of dynamical systems. Some of these are: the cell cycle, signaling pathways and networks of interacting genes synthesizing proteins. In all these systems, events unfold as a function of time. Dynamical systems of various types have been extensively studied in the physical and mathematical sciences.
